Crótalo.
Crótalo.
Crótalo.
Escarabajo sonoro.
En la araña
de la mano
rizas el aire
cálido,
y te ahogas en tu trino
de palo.
Crótalo.
Crótalo.
Crótalo.
Escarabajo sonoro.

Castanet
Language: English  after the Spanish (Español)
Castanet.
Castanet.
Castanet.
Raucous black beetle.
In the spider legs
of a hand
you curl the hot
air
and drown in your trill
of wood.
Castanet.
Castanet.
Castanet.
Raucous black beetle.
